#d60d18 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#d60d18 is composed of 83.9% red, 5.1%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 93.9% magenta, 88.8%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 356.7 degrees, a saturation of 88.5% and a lightness of 44.5%. #d60d18 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ff1a30 with #ad0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

● #d60d18 color description : Strong red.
The hexadecimal color #d60d18 has RGB values of R:214, G:13, B:24 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.94, Y:0.89,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14028056.

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0101 is the darkest color, while #fff7f8 is the lightest one.
